Set the Language for a Page
Last modified by Eleni Cojocariu on 2026/05/11 13:18
Steps
To set the language (previously called "Locale") for the current Page:
- Go to the "Information" tab and click on the Edit pencil icon next to the "Language" section.

- Select the content language you want to use from the dropdown:

- Save the modifications (or discard them).

FAQ
Why am I not seeing the Edit pencil icon next to the "Language" section?
- It's probably because your administrator hasn't set up your wiki to be multilingual.
- It could be because you're viewing a translation and not the Original content (Default Page Content) of the Page.
Why do I see "Locale" instead of "Language" in the "Information" tab?
XWiki <17.8.0, <17.4.5 There were some inconsistencies of wording and the UI displayed "Locale".
